"""
Test for bullet lists in CommonMark parsers.
Cf. the `CommonMark Specification <https://spec.commonmark.org/>`__
"""
from pathlib import Path
import sys
import unittest
if __name__ == '__main__':
# prepend the "docutils root" to the Python library path
# so we import the local `docutils` package.
sys.path.insert(0, str(Path(__file__).resolve().parents[3]))
from docutils.frontend import get_default_settings
from docutils.parsers.recommonmark_wrapper import Parser
from docutils.utils import new_document
class RecommonmarkParserTestCase(unittest.TestCase):
def test_parser(self):
parser = Parser()
settings = get_default_settings(Parser)
for name, cases in totest.items():
for casenum, (case_input, case_expected) in enumerate(cases):
with self.subTest(id=f'totest[{name!r}][{casenum}]'):
document = new_document('test data', settings.copy())
parser.parse(case_input, document)
output = document.pformat()
self.assertEqual(case_expected, output)
